Warehouse Order Planner Job in Aurora, Illinois US

Warehouse Order Planner

Our customer, a leading 3rd party logistics company in the west suburbs, has an immediate opening for a Warehouse Order Planner. Job Summary -Plans the orders in the Warehouse Management System and monitors the matrix system to determine high priority versus low priority orders -Manages the daily flow of orders and delegates orders to warehouse pickers -Reviews documents such as production schedules, work orders, and staffing tables to determine personnel and materials requirements. -Creates reports in Excel and records order data, including orders shipped, picking/packing productivity rates, and quality control measures. -Maintains inventory data necessary to meet order demands -Communicates with Help Desk to resolve WMS issues -Serves as a liaison between Customers and Operations Team -Participates in Lean Warehousing system on floor -Spends about 75% of their time on the computer and 25% on the warehouse floor Working hours: 2:30 pm--12:00 am May require flexiblity for coverage; Overtime as needed Skills Qualifications -High School diploma or equivalent required, related college courses preferred -Previous experience utilizing Warehouse Management Systems -Knowledge of quality control, costs, and other techniques for maximizing the effective assembly and distribution of goods -Knowledge of business and management principles involved in strategic planning, resource allocation, and coordination of people and resources. -Strong Microsoft Excel skills required -Compiling, coding, categorizing, calculating, auditing, or verifying information or data. -Must be able to work independently and with little supervision -All candidates must successfully pass a criminal background check, drug test, present two professional references Interested in joining our team?
